Transaction 3c06901004e8521aff7d14527669758d21acaec70ff9d5a3047acdf7412598e8

2 Input
2 Outputs
  • 3c06901004e8521aff7d14527669758d21acaec70ff9d5a3047acdf7412598e8:0
  • value  1857800
    address  3JJ4LULa6VtcVVxZC9tsNN9JM693mcrCeE
  • 3c06901004e8521aff7d14527669758d21acaec70ff9d5a3047acdf7412598e8:1
  • value  14346
    address  bc1q244zh2s7p7kgjeqkprv84cpgjdwsdvhtwdtvpa